diff options
Diffstat (limited to 'public/javascripts/diff_browser.js')
-rw-r--r-- | public/javascripts/diff_browser.js |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/public/javascripts/diff_browser.js b/public/javascripts/diff_browser.js index 3b78ad1..9e38e2d 100644 --- a/public/javascripts/diff_browser.js +++ b/public/javascripts/diff_browser.js @@ -548,7 +548,8 @@ Gitorious.enableCommenting = function() { $(this).parent().addClass("selected-for-commenting"); }) var allLineNumbers = $(diffTable).find("td.ui-selected").map(function(){ - return $(this).text(); + var lineNo = $(this).parent().attr("class").replace(/[\sa-z\-]*/g,""); + return lineNo; }); var path = $(diffTable).parent().prev(".header").children(".title").text(); var commentForm = new Gitorious.CommentForm(path); @@ -605,8 +606,7 @@ Gitorious.CommentForm = function(path){ this.numbers = result; } this.linesAsString = function() { - var sortedLines = this.numbers.sort(); - return sortedLines[0] + ".." + sortedLines[sortedLines.length - 1]; + return this.numbers.min() + ".." + this.numbers.max(); } this.hasLines = function() { return this.numbers.length > 0; |